Average cost of fence fitters in West Dulwich

When budgeting for new fencing, you should be aware of how you may be charged. Typically, fencers in West Dulwich charge per job or per metre, rather than by the hour, since the work depends on materials, layout, and preparation needed.

For smaller tasks like repairs or replacements, some West Dulwich fence fitters may charge £25 to £40 per hour or £180 to £300 per day. For full installations, expect to pay around £60 to £120 per metre, including materials and labour.

The total cost will also depend on the type of fence you choose - for example, basic plastic panels start from around £25 to £40 per panel, while premium metal or composite fencing can cost £80 to £150 per panel.

Questions to ask a fencer in West Dulwich

Before making the final decision to hire the right fencer in West Dulwich, you want to be sure you choose the most suitable tradesperson for your requirements. Asking a few key questions will make sure you do just that. Understand fencer’s experience and approach by asking these questions:

Do you provide a written quote that includes all materials and labour?

Always request a detailed written quote before any work begins, and be sure you know what it includes - typically, it will cover labour, materials (including posts, panels, fixings, and concrete), and sometimes waste disposal. A clear quote helps avoid unexpected costs later.

What materials do you recommend for my garden fence?

The right fencing contractor in West Dulwich will consider your garden’s layout, soil type, and exposure to wind or moisture before suggesting materials like timber, composite, or metal. Their advice can help you choose the most durable and cost-effective option.

Will you handle old fence removal and site cleanup?

Check if waste removal is included in the quote, or will be charged at an extra cost. Many fencers offer this as part of the service, but it’s always best to confirm before work starts.

How long will the fencing work take to complete?

Timeframes can vary depending on weather, access, and the length of fencing. Asking this upfront helps you plan ahead, especially if you need the job completed before a specific date.

Do you hold public liability insurance?

Make sure your fencing contractor holds public liability insurance. This protects both you and them in case of accidental damage or injury during the job.

Do you offer a guarantee on your fencing work?

Professional fencers in West Dulwich typically offer a guarantee covering workmanship and materials. Confirm the length and terms of the warranty to ensure peace of mind once the job is complete.

Frequently asked questions about fencing in West Dulwich

Do I need planning permission to install a new fence when hiring fencers in West Dulwich?

Most garden fences don’t require planning permission if they’re under 2 metres high (around 6.5 feet), but this may vary if your home is listed or located in a conservation area. Always check with your local authority before work begins.

Do fencers in West Dulwich remove old fencing?

Yes, many fencing contractors in West Dulwich include removal and disposal of old panels and posts in their service, but always check this is covered in your written quote to avoid extra charges.

Do West Dulwich fencing contractors provide the fencing materials, or does the customer need to source them?

This depends on the fencer. Some fence fitters in West Dulwich prefer to supply all materials to guarantee quality and fit, while others are happy to install fencing that you’ve purchased yourself. Always confirm before work begins.

How long does it take fencers in West Dulwich to install a new fence?

A typical domestic fencing job takes 1 to 3 days, depending on the length, material, and condition of the ground. More complex or sloped gardens may take longer.

Can a fencer in West Dulwich repair part of a fence instead of replacing it all?

Yes, fencers in West Dulwich can typically replace damaged panels, posts, or sections without needing to redo the entire fence. They’ll inspect the structure first to determine whether repair or replacement is more cost-effective.
